Cloud computing has an added advantages when compared to Cluster and Grid Computing then provides an economical and efficient solution for sharing group resource among cloud users. Due to the burden of local data storage and maintenance, user depend the Third-party auditor (TPA) to check the integrity of outsourced data and be worry free. Nowadays trusting the TPA for sharing the outsourced data in a cloud storage is still a challenging issue because TPA also can theft the outsourced data while sharing the data in multiple user so security issues arises rapidly. To overcome the cloud security issues, in this project propose a three efficient storage techniques or schemes (i) multi owner data sharing scheme (MOS) for creating dynamic groups in the cloud (ii) Digital signature method for file processing and (iii) Applying the Digital Forensics method, it monitoring the user behavior and providing decoy files using Offensive Decoy Technology. These three proposed schemes will provide the solution for highly securable and efficient.
